Step back in time with this image of a bus filled with passengers making their way to the iconic US Grant Hotel in San Diego, California, USA, circa 1915. The open-top bus, adorned with ornate details and boasting a regal presence, was a popular mode of transportation during this era. The passengers, dressed in their finest attire, seem excited and eager for their arrival at the grand US Grant Hotel. The US Grant Hotel, a National Historic Landmark, was named after Ulysses S. Grant, the 18th President of the United States. This Beaux-Arts masterpiece, designed by architects Carleton Winslow and Charles Dickey, opened its doors in 1910 and quickly became a symbol of luxury and sophistication in San Diego. The bus, with its vintage charm, adds to the historical significance of this photograph. The top deck offers a panoramic view of the bustling city, allowing passengers to take in the beauty of San Diego as they approach their destination. This image not only showcases the rich history of transportation in America but also highlights the elegance and grandeur of the US Grant Hotel during the early 20th century. The US Grant Hotel continues to be a beloved landmark in San Diego, attracting visitors from around the world. This photograph serves as a reminder of the hotel's storied past and the role it played in shaping the city's history.
